    Watercolor painting (painted with artist paint and natural, plant-derived paint)

    I feel so lucky to have this stunning and spacious wooded park less than 5 minutes from my home. I hiked along one of their trails in the autumn (best time to go) and recently, I came here for a meet-up event hosted by Greenbelt - watercoloring painting. In a nearby cabin, a group of us sat and painted with a variety of natural, plant-derived paints made from berries found right here in the Greenbelt! They also had store-bought watercolor paints as well. I used both natural and artist watercolor paint in my piece. After we finished painting, most of us left for a 30 minute walk through the area. We found some of the berries we painted with earlier along the trail and walked across a small bridge over a pond on the way back. Although it was a very hot day, the variety of tall trees that surrounded us provided a leafy canopy, creating a path that is cooler than the city sidewalks and nearby golf course. You can lose track of time and forget very quickly you are in the fast-spaced city once you step inside these quiet woods. What I recommend for a visit here: A bottle of water Some bug spray A good pair of sneakers A small snack like a granola bar And of course, your phone or camera

    This is the gem of Staten Island outdoor activity. You can hike for hours and not come across the same path. The trails are well preserved and if you're into birding there are a decent number of species to see.

    This review is for the awesome splash pad that is located in Wheeler Park. Every time we go we…read morehave a blast! I am also so happy that Wheeler park welcomes everyone from all over NJ (and elsewhere). Coming from out of the county will cost you a bit more, but not much. If you live outside of Union County it is $4.00 for kids ($2.00 in county) and $6.00 for adults ($3.00 in county). This splash pad has every water feature a kid could ever need - from bigger twisty water slides, to a small dragon water slide. Also, water guns that you can shoot each other with, a pirate boat, water shooting up from the ground, and much more. My kids spent a little over 2 hours here and had an absolute blast. We've been here about 3 times and it never disappoints. Just be sure to bring some sort of shade covering. There isn't much cover at the splash pad so we usually bring our small beach tent with us. There is also a dry playground in the splash pad gated area where kids can play too. They have staff who help keep the kids safe and to make sure everyone goes down the water slides safe and sound. I highly recommend Wheeler Spray Park on a hot summer day.
